Nodos n8n guía completa es uno de los usos más prácticos de n8n. Los nodos de n8n son los bloques básicos con los que construyes cualquier automatización. Cada nodo realiza una acción específica: enviar un email, leer una hoja de cálculo, hacer una llamada a una API, filtrar datos, ejecutar código… En esta guía aprenderás todo lo que necesitas saber sobre los nodos de n8n.
¿Qué es un nodo en n8n?
Un nodo es una pieza funcional dentro de un flujo de trabajo (workflow) en n8n. Cada nodo tiene una función concreta: puede ser un disparador (trigger) que inicia el flujo, o una acción que procesa o envía datos. Los nodos se conectan entre sí pasando datos de uno al siguiente.
Tipos de nodos en n8n
1. Nodos de disparo (Trigger Nodes)
Son los nodos que inician un flujo. Pueden activarse de diferentes maneras:
- Schedule Trigger: Ejecuta el flujo en horarios programados (cada hora, cada día, etc.)
- Webhook Trigger: Se activa cuando llega una petición HTTP externa
- Email Trigger (IMAP): Se activa cuando llega un nuevo email
- Form Trigger: Se activa cuando alguien completa un formulario
2. Nodos de aplicaciones (App Nodes)
Conectan n8n con servicios y aplicaciones externas. Son los más numerosos. Algunos ejemplos populares:
- Google Sheets: Leer, escribir y actualizar datos en hojas de cálculo
- Gmail / Outlook: Enviar y gestionar correos electrónicos
- Slack: Enviar mensajes y notificaciones
- Notion: Gestionar bases de datos y páginas
- Airtable: Leer y escribir registros
- HTTP Request: Hacer llamadas a cualquier API externa
- OpenAI: Usar modelos de IA como GPT-4
- Telegram: Enviar mensajes y gestionar bots
- WhatsApp: Enviar mensajes de WhatsApp Business
3. Nodos de lógica y control de flujo
Permiten controlar el flujo de ejecución y procesar datos:
- IF: Bifurca el flujo según una condición (verdadero/falso)
- Switch: Bifurca el flujo en múltiples rutas según el valor de un dato
- Merge: Combina datos de múltiples ramas del flujo
- Loop Over Items: Repite una acción para cada elemento de una lista
- Wait: Pausa el flujo durante un tiempo determinado
- Stop and Error: Detiene el flujo y genera un error
4. Nodos de transformación de datos
- Set: Define o modifica valores de los datos
- Edit Fields: Modifica campos específicos de los datos
- Code: Ejecuta código JavaScript o Python personalizado
- Function: Procesa datos con funciones personalizadas
- Aggregate: Agrupa y resume datos
- Sort: Ordena elementos
- Filter: Filtra elementos según criterios
Nodos más populares de n8n
Nodo HTTP Request
Es uno de los nodos más poderosos de n8n. Te permite conectarte a cualquier API externa que no tenga un nodo nativo. Puedes hacer peticiones GET, POST, PUT, DELETE y configurar headers, autenticación y body de forma visual.
Nodo Code
Permite ejecutar JavaScript o Python directamente dentro del flujo. Es extremadamente útil para transformaciones de datos complejas, cálculos o cualquier lógica que no se pueda hacer con nodos visuales.
Nodo AI Agent
Uno de los nodos más potentes de n8n moderno. Permite crear agentes de IA que pueden usar herramientas, tomar decisiones y completar tareas complejas de forma autónoma usando modelos de lenguaje como GPT-4 o Claude.
Cómo usar un nodo en n8n: paso a paso
- Haz clic en el botón «+» en el canvas del editor de n8n
- Busca el nodo que necesitas en el buscador (ej: «Google Sheets»)
- Selecciona la acción que quieres realizar (ej: «Append Row»)
- Configura las credenciales si el nodo las requiere
- Define los parámetros del nodo (qué hoja, qué columnas, qué datos)
- Conecta el nodo con el anterior y el siguiente en el flujo
- Prueba el nodo usando el botón «Test step»
Expresiones en los nodos de n8n
Una de las funcionalidades más poderosas es el uso de expresiones dentro de los parámetros de cualquier nodo. Las expresiones te permiten referenciar datos de nodos anteriores usando la sintaxis {{ $json.nombre_campo }}.
Por ejemplo, si el nodo anterior devuelve un campo «email», puedes usarlo en el siguiente nodo con: {{ $json.email }}
¿Cuántos nodos tiene n8n?
n8n cuenta con más de 400 nodos nativos que cubren las aplicaciones más populares del mercado: Google Workspace, Microsoft 365, Slack, Notion, GitHub, Stripe, OpenAI, Telegram, WhatsApp Business y muchos más. Además, puedes crear nodos personalizados si necesitas integraciones muy específicas.
Para aprender más sobre cómo combinar nodos en flujos completos, consulta nuestro Manual de n8n en español o nuestra guía de conceptos básicos de n8n.


